Roast Beef Sliders
These roast beef sliders are mini sandwiches made from connected dinner rolls filled with deli roast beef and provolone cheese, then brushed with a garlic-butter sauce and baked. They take under 30 minutes to make.

  • Servings: 12

Ingredients

  • (12) Dinner rolls, connected
  • (3/4 lb) Grass-fed Top Round Roast
  • (12 slices) Provolone cheese
  • (3 tablespoons) Butter, melted
  • (1/2 teaspoon) Garlic powder
  • (1/2 teaspoon) Dried parsley
  • (1 teaspoon) Worcestershire sauce

Directions

  • Follow this Classic Roast Beef recipe before assembling the sliders.
  • Preheat your oven to 375°F and line a baking sheet with aluminum foil.
  • Slice the connected dinner rolls horizontally so you have a top and bottom layer, keeping them intact as two slabs.
  • Set the bottom half on the prepared baking sheet. Arrange half of the cheese slices over it, followed by all the roast beef, then the remaining cheese. Place the top slab back on.
  • In a small bowl, mix together the melted butter, garlic powder, parsley, and Worcestershire sauce. Brush this mixture evenly over the tops of the rolls.
  • Bake for 10–12 minutes, until the tops are golden brown and the cheese is melted.
  • Remove from the oven and let the sliders rest for about 5 minutes. Transfer to a cutting board, then use a serrated knife to slice them apart for serving.
